Dallas Stars defenseman Sergei Gonchar will be out for 3-5 weeks because of a fracture in his ankle, general manager Jim Nill told the Stars website.
Gonchar, 40, has two assists and a plus-3 rating in three preseason games. He had 22 points in 2013-14 while averaging 17:36 of ice time in 76 regular-season games. He had zero points and a minus-3 rating in six Stanley Cup Playoff games.
The news was better for goaltender Kari Lehtonen. He practiced Thursday and Ruff said Lehtonen was healthy after missing time with a concussion sustained Monday during a preseason game against the Florida Panthers.
